One extreme tactic in the game is Social Sabotage Level Extreme. This allows players to sabotage the rival's social life, frame them for a crime, get them expelled, or even lead them to the point of suicide by encouraging other girls at school to bully them. The main character in Yandere Simulator is Ayano Aishi, also known as “Yandere-chan,” a schoolgirl who is obsessively in love with her senpai. Her mission is to eliminate anyone whom she thinks is a threat to gaining her senpai's attention.

If Ayano hides Nemesis's corpse in a garbage bag (without disguising as a female student), it will disappear.
It's interesting to note that even if Ayano moves a body far away from the crime scene after a Teacher's Pet reports a murder, the teacher will assume it was a prank and won't involve the police, as long as no other evidence has been cleaned up. The story of Ayano's parents is also revealed in the game, where Ayano's mother, Ryoba, fell in love with Ayano's father, Jokichi, instantly upon seeing him – all based on a dream she had.
